Little People’s Story Time Hatching at Nana’s

Dixon's newest children's boutique will be offering a free story time, to alternate with the library's story time hour, giving children a weekly story.

Preschool-age children are invited to hear stories about spring and enjoy songs and fingerplays at the new children’s boutique in downtown Dixon, ‘Nana and Company.’

The free story time is being coordinated on alternating Wednesdays with the story time to help provide a weekly experience for children, said owner Debra Dingman.

“We have scheduled some guest readers including our Mayor, Jack Batchelor, who really have fun reading to the children and who know how important it is to foster the pleasure of reading in them,” she said.
